1791 Newte Tour of SCOTLAND 1ed England Castles Loch Lomond William Thomson RARE William Thomson was an 18th-century Scottish historian who published his works under the name Thomas Newte. Thomson’s most important work was his book ‘Prospects and Observations on a Tour of England’ in which he describes Newte’s excursion through Great Britain. While the character of Newte and his family are fictional, the descriptions are not. This book describes locations such as Loch-Lomond, Cawdor Castle, Perth, history of ancient Scottish family feuds (Montrose vs Argyll), Edinburgh and castle, York, and so much more. This 1791 first edition of Newte’s ‘Tour’ includes impressive, full-page illustrated views of Scotland and England landscapes and castles.
